Activity 20 B : Premium for non-produced milk – Solution

The measure is effective when the payment amount is at least 4 cents per litre. That way, M. Fourhooves produces a lot less milk (320000 L) and his income is slightly higher. He changes feeding type and opts for a “grass-based” diet for his dairy cows, which reduces productivity per cow.

Wheat production increases for he reduces the number of his cows : his maize needs go down and he can therefore decrease production of maize.

Under optimum conditions :

Price of milk 0.27 0.27 0.27 0.27
Premium 0 0.02 0.03 0.04
Dairy cow / « intensive » diet 53.846 53.846 53.846 5.242
Heifer / « intensive » diet 16.154 16.154 16.154 1.573
Calf (sold) / « intensive » diet 32.308 32.308 32.308 3.145
Dairy cow / « grass-based » diet 2.564 2.564 2.564  40.367
Heifer / « grass-based » 0.769 0.769 0.769 12.110
Calf (sold) / « grass-based » diet 1.538 1.538 1.538 24.220
Milk production 402410 L 402410 L 402410 L 320000 L
Wheat 19.977 ha 19.977 ha 19.977 ha 25.377 ha
Maize 10.023 ha 10.023 ha 10.023 ha 4.623 ha
Prairies permanentes 20 ha 20 ha 20 ha 20 ha
Income of the farmer 36923.683 36923.683 36923.683 37037.889
